either hydraulics, or the pressure plate or maybe even the something on the thrust bearing fork!!
how sure are you that its a brand name, brand new clutch, could also be a poor quality re-con!!
get some one to press the clutch pedal and see how much movement there is on the pin!!
just quick thoughts
good luck!!